She sat on the bed upstairs, listening to the shower run, and the crickets sing. She took in the surroundings of where she'd be sleeping for the next few nights - looking at a desk, a few board games stacked on top: Scrabble. There was something about staying at other people's places. Even a mansion like this: you can't wait to get back to your own bed. And even if the cats are more friendly than your own, even if the place is gorgeous, even if you can not have to worry about locking up at night, there's no place like home. She tried to ignore the fly buzzing around the room. Still, on the other hand, she couldn't wait to check the place out in daylight... and jump into the pool.
